LG unveils Optimus GK, a Galaxy S4 competitor

LG has announced a new Android smartphone in the South Korean market today. Packing a manageable 5-inch full HD display, LG Optimus GK brings the hefty specs from Optimus G Pro in a comparably smaller package.LG Optimus GK

Optimus GK is also the first real competitor to Samsung’s Galaxy S4 from the company, as LG’s other high-end smartphones either lack on from the specs front and are too big to compete with the Samsung flagship.

Samsung Galaxy Note 3 image appears online (Update)

An alleged image of Samsung’s upcoming Galaxy Note II successor has appeared online. Spotting a 5.9-inch display, Galaxy Note 3 looks considerably large in size compared to Galaxy Note II. Posted on Baidu forums, this image is said to be of an engineering sample of Note 3, so chances are that the final design might be little different than this.Samsung Galaxy Note 3

As per the accompanying specs and previous rumours, Samsung Galaxy Note 3 will feature a 5.9-inch full HD display, 2.0 GHz Exynos 5 Octa processor, 3GB of RAM and 32GB of internal storage. The phone also reportedly runs on Android 4.2.2.

LG starts global roll-out of Optimus F5 LTE

LG has announced that it is finally starting to sell the Optimus F5 LTE smartphone and it will go on sale in France tomorrow, followed by other European countries. The phone will also be released in South and Central America, Asia and the Commonwealth of Independent States over the next few weeks.LG Optimus F5

Originally showcased at Mobile World Congress, LG F-series of devices come with 4G LTE connectivity coupled with decent specifications. They are in no way competitors to the high-end phones and aim to bring LTE devices to the mass market.

Samsung to launch 8-inch tablet in June, Galaxy S4 Mini in July: WSJ

WSJ hasn’t just spilled the beans on the rugged Galaxy S4, but the paper also reports that Samsung will be launching a new 8-inch Galaxy-series tablet in June. This report is in line with a recent rumour that also suggested that Samsung is working on a new 8-inch tablet, which will come with an AMOLED full HD display.

“Samsung is planning to launch the new Galaxy-line tablet in June, according to a person familiar with the matter, adding to the seven-inch and 10.1-inch versions on the market,” WSJ writes.

WSJ report is a little low on tablet details, but does reveal the expected launch schedule of Galaxy S4 Mini. According to the report, Samsung will introduce 4.3-inch display sporting Galaxy S4 Mini in July.Samsung Galaxy S4 Mini

This is not the first time we are hearing about S4 Mini, the previous rumours have suggested that the phone will feature qHD resolution display along with a 1.6GHz dual-core processor – probably Exynos 5210.

Sony to launch Xperia ZR with 4.6-inch HD display, quad-core CPU & 13MP camera

Sony is reportedly planning to supplement Xperia Z with a new model, which will fill the gap between Xperia Z and Xperia SP smartphones. Dubbed as Xperia ZR, this phone will come with the model number C550x.Sony-Xperia-logo

Sony Xperia ZR will be featuring a 4.6-inch 1280x720p display. The phone will be powered by a Qualcomm 1.5GHz quad-core processor. The phone will also come with 2GB of RAM, 8GB of internal storage and 2,300 mAh battery.

Samsung launches Galaxy S4 in India, priced at INR 41,500

Samsung India today took the wraps of Galaxy S4 smartphone at a press event in Kingdom of Dreams, Gurgaon. The smartphone has been priced at INR 41,500 (16GB) and will be available beginning tomorrow i.e. April 27.Samsung Galaxy S 4

The company has unveiled the Exynos 5 Octa powered variant in the country, making India, one of the few markets to get this octa-core version of Galaxy S4. Other markets like United States will be getting Snapdragon 600 quad-core processor powered-variant.
